Transaction ddba6828dfe41d4e779768d22ad70e3931c0b8deabb4dfbd652b77c38b79f533
1 Input
1 Output
-
ddba6828dfe41d4e779768d22ad70e3931c0b8deabb4dfbd652b77c38b79f533:0
- value
- 1404484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6e7d3df63ffe78a4bd266ee98820827ae1e1758 OP_EQUAL
- address
- 3MHLFG7cYcYDRXTs5d1wTSJVGDHKTbSruC